Bug description:
  ardour 1:5.4.0~dfsg-2 is stuck in zesty-proposed because xjadeo is in
  multiverse.

  > ardour-video-timeline/amd64 unsatisfiable Depends: xjadeo (>= 0.6.4)

  xjadeo is in Debian main so there does not appear to be a reason to
  not move xjadeo to universe.

  $ check-mir 
  Checking support status of build dependencies...
   * libavcodec-dev binary and source package is in universe
   * libavformat-dev binary and source package is in universe
   * libavutil-dev binary and source package is in universe
   * libswscale-dev binary and source package is in universe
   * libimlib2-dev binary and source package is in universe
   * libjack-dev binary and source package is in universe
   * liblo-dev binary and source package is in universe
   * libportmidi-dev binary and source package is in universe
   * libltc-dev binary and source package is in universe

  Checking support status of binary dependencies...
   * mencoder binary and source package is in universe
   * transcode does not exist (pure virtual?)

  (transcode is only a recommends)

  I intended to install MEGA Sync Client, Google Chrome and Dropbox by
  downloading the needed packages from their websites (respectively
  https://mega.nz/#sync and https://www.google.com/chrome/ and
  https://www.dropbox.com/install?os=lnx ). I opened the packages one by
  one with gnome-software and pressed Install - nothing, except for a
  super-quick progress bar animation, happened. No matter how many times
  I tried, same result. Also, an icon pops up on the panel saying
  "Waiting to install", but nothing seems to happen.

  This only seems to happen with third-party packages; installing a
  random deb from packages.ubuntu.com/xenial worked.

  I even tried to reinstall the system to make this work, but same
  problem.

  Gdebi, however, installs the packages as expected.
